Warning Signs You Need Apartment Water Extraction

Ignoring the sign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and a prolonged recovery process. Don’t wait until it’s too late here are some warning signs that you need apartment water ext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old and mildew growth, which can be hazardous to your health. Don’t ignore the smell it’s a sign that you need professional help to remove the moisture and pr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ause your flooring to warp or buckle, which can lead to costly repairs. Don’t delay, address the issue now to prevent further damage and ensure a smooth recovery process.

Visible Water Stains

Water stains on your walls or ceiling can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ore the stains they can lead to further damage and costly repairs if left untreated.

Apartment Water Extraction Cost in Westworth Village, TX

The cost of apartment water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500 but can be higher in severe cases. Our team will provide a customized estimate based on your specific needs and situ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Drying and d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and duration of drying process.
Cleaning and sanitizing $100 – $500 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and level of contamination.
Final inspection and restoration $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and level of damage.
Emergency response and assessment $100 – $500 Time of day,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
